A Widening Gap between Growth and Sustainability

Explore the tensions between growth and sustainability—and discover how cities can balance development and future well-being.

Cities today face a widening gap between economic growth and sustainability. This unit examines the trade-offs of urban migration, overcrowding, compact development, and industrialization—showing both the opportunities and risks. You’ll learn how rapid growth can strain infrastructure, ecosystems, and social well-being, and why integrating clean growth strategies, green technologies, and sustainable policies is vital.
